Effect of inhibition of SG formation on apoptotic sensitivity in polyamine-deficient IECs. A: images of apoptotic cell death after treatment with and without TNFα/CHX for 4 h. Cells were treated with DFMO for 4 days and then transfected with C-siRNA, siSort1, or siTIA-1 for 48 h in the presence of DFMO. After cells were treated with arsenite for 45 min, they were exposed to TNFα/CHX for 4 h: control cells transfected with C-siRNA (a), DFMO-treated cells transfected with C-siRNA and then exposed to arsenite (b), DFMO-treated cells transfected with siSort1 and treated with arsenite (c), DFMO-treated cells transfected with siTIA-1 and treated with arsenite (d), and DFMO-treated cells cotransfected with siSort1 and TIA-1 and treated with arsenite (e). Original magnification, ×150. B: percentage of apoptotic cells as described in A. Values are means ± SE of data from 6 samples. *,+P < 0.05 compared with No-TNFα/CHX and DFMO-treated cells transfected with C-siRNA and then treated with TNFα/CHX, respectively.
